Career path

Career Role (Biomedical Engineering & Athletic Performance) Description
Biomedical Engineer: Sports Technology Develop and implement innovative technologies for enhancing athletic performance, injury prevention, and rehabilitation. Focus on wearable sensors, biomechanics analysis.
Sports Scientist (Biomechanics Specialist) Analyze athlete movement using advanced biomechanical techniques and principles; provide data-driven insights for performance optimization. Strong biomedical engineering background needed.
Rehabilitation Engineer (Sports Medicine) Design and implement rehabilitation programs leveraging biomedical engineering principles; focus on recovery, injury prevention using innovative devices and strategies.
Data Scientist: Athletic Performance Analyze large datasets from wearable sensors and performance tracking systems; build predictive models for injury risk and performance enhancement using advanced algorithms and statistics.
